温馨提示×

centos清理损坏的包

小樊
50
2025-09-05 21:32:53
栏目: 智能运维

在CentOS系统中,如果需要清理损坏的包,可以按照以下步骤操作:

方法一:使用yum命令

  1. 更新软件包列表

    sudo yum update
    
  2. 检查并移除损坏的包

    sudo yum check
    

    这个命令会列出所有有问题的包。

  3. 移除损坏的包: 根据yum check的输出,使用以下命令移除损坏的包:

    sudo yum remove <package_name>
    

    <package_name>替换为实际的包名。

  4. 清理缓存: 清理yum缓存以释放磁盘空间:

    sudo yum clean all
    

方法二:使用dnf命令(适用于CentOS 8及以上版本)

  1. 更新软件包列表

    sudo dnf update
    
  2. 检查并移除损坏的包

    sudo dnf check
    

    这个命令会列出所有有问题的包。

  3. 移除损坏的包: 根据dnf check的输出,使用以下命令移除损坏的包:

    sudo dnf remove <package_name>
    

    <package_name>替换为实际的包名。

  4. 清理缓存: 清理dnf缓存以释放磁盘空间:

    sudo dnf clean all
    

注意事项

  • 在移除包之前,确保这些包不是系统关键组件的一部分。
  • 如果不确定某个包是否安全移除,可以先查阅相关文档或咨询专业人士。
  • 定期运行yum checkdnf check可以帮助及时发现并处理损坏的包。

通过以上步骤,你可以有效地清理CentOS系统中损坏的包,保持系统的稳定性和性能。

0